Abstract

In this rapid technological development era, students need to adapt to technology. Quick Response Code Indonesian Standard (QRIS) is a form of innovation in the payment system that has been recognized as effective. Financial literacy is a good provision in using financial inclusion optimally so that people can experience optimal benefits from using financial products, which in this case is QRIS. This research aims to examine the effect of financial literacy and financial inclusion on decisions to use QRIS. The data in this research uses primary data and was obtained by distributing questionnaires to 100 respondents. This research used quantitative analysis methods and was processed using the Smartpls 4.0 tool. The testing in this research used the Structural Equation Modeling analysis method with Partial Least Square (SEM-PLS) with results showing that financial literacy and financial inclusion had a positive and significant effect on the decision to use QRIS.
